Loading ....

$21 trillion in unaccounted spending to the war machine. It’s funny, that’s the same amount of debt out country carries.

“While the documents are incomplete, original government sources indicate $21 trillion in unsupported adjustments have been reported for the Department of Defense and the Department of Housing and Urban Development for the years 1998-2015.”

Has Our Government Spent $21 Trillion Of Our Money Without Telling Us?

In recent decades, the Office of Inspector General has reported some $21 trillion (you read that right) in unsubstantiated payments by the Departments of Defense and Housing and Urban Development. It’s time for Congress to investigate these outlays and their funding source.